Questions for your doctor about tooth injuries

Preparing questions in advance can help patients to have more meaningful discussions with their dentists regarding their treatment options. The following questions related to tooth injuries may be helpful:

  1. How can I lower my risk of tooth injury?

  2. If I injure a tooth, should I call a dentist or my physician?

  3. What are the odds that a tooth can be saved after being knocked out for more than 30 minutes?

  4. Is my tooth injury complicated or uncomplicated?

  5. Is there a chance that my mouth will reject a reimplanted tooth?

  6. Will I have to see the dentist more regularly after having a tooth reimplanted?

  7. Will I require cosmetic surgery to enhance the appearance of the tooth.

  8. What are my options if a permanent tooth cannot be saved?

  9. Can I take pain reliever medications to reduce soreness?

  10. Which sports require the use of a mouth guard, or a helmet with mouth protection?
